Debt peonage refers to a condition where individuals are forced to work to pay off a debt, often under exploitative conditions. This practice effectively traps workers in a cycle of indebtedness, as the terms of repayment are often manipulated to ensure they can never fully pay off what they owe. Historically, it has been associated with agricultural labor and has been used as a means of controlling marginalized populations. Debt peonage is considered a form of modern-day slavery in many contexts.
